
This is an ok tool , the chuck is kind of crappy and it's doubtful it will last .if the rest holds up replace it with a Jacobs key type [$32.00]I would use this drill for small jobs around the house,not on the job . But it's cheap enough .I can remember paying $185.00 for a 1/4" B&D drill when they were made in Maryland , 30 years later it still works fine ,just had to replace the cord.I'm sure the current crop of tools will have a short useful life.
